ABOUT THE ROLE
CountryPlace Mortgage, a leading nationwide personal property, mortgage and commercial lender headquartered in Plano, TX, is seeking a Quality Control Analyst II to join our growing Quality Control Department. This in-person role is based in our Plano, TX office. The Quality Control Analyst II focuses on reviewing financial products to ensure accuracy, completeness, and adherence to regulatory standards. This position plays a critical role in identifying potential risks, improving operational efficiency, and supporting the company's efforts to maintain high standards of customer service and regulatory compliance.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
- Conduct advanced pre- and post-closing quality control reviews of consumer, mortgage and commercial loan products with a focus on complex loan structures and high-risk transactions
- Independently analyze loan applications, credit reports, underwriting decisions, disclosures, surveys, title policies, appraisals and customer communications for all loan products
- Maintain subject matter expertise in mortgage regulations, agency guidelines and loan program requirements
- Verify calculations for income, loan to value (LTV) calculation and debt to income (DTI)
- Perform detailed audits of loan servicing, including escrow management, loan modifications, delinquencies, default management, and customer service interactions
